#7178b4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7178b4 is composed of 44.3% red, 47.1%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.2% cyan, 33.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 233.7 degrees, a saturation of 30.9% and a lightness of 57.5%. #7178b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#e2f0ff with #000069.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

● #7178b4 color description : Slightly desaturated blue.
#7178b4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7178b4 has RGB values of R:113, G:120,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0.37, M:0.33,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 7436468.
